Overview

The Community Therapy Team Brighton and Hove is looking for an administrator to work within the team based at Brighton General Hospital. The role will involve supporting the day-to-day delivery of the community therapy service by providing first line contact to service users and other professionals. The post holder must have good organisational and communication skills and be able to work under their own initiative and follow directions. They must also be actively engaged in service development for both administrative and clinical processes to maximise efficiency and ensure a good patient experience.


Responsibilities

* Processing incoming information including patient referrals and registering referrals on System One (referrals are received online, via telephone, other health professionals and other electronically received correspondence).
* Providing other administrative support including stock control, monitoring of email inboxes, scanning, stock management and processing subject access requests.
* Receiving calls into the service, responding to queries and requests, gathering relevant information to ensure clear information is obtained and forwarded to the community therapy team clinical coordinators, clinical leads and relevant staff members.
* Devising and maintaining efficient filing, clerical and office systems, and providing administrative support to the teams, including photocopying and dealing with internal/external post.
* Monitoring and maintaining stocks of therapy supplies, stationery, equipment and resources for the team.
* Monitoring generic therapy mailbox, managing tasks and batch reports; processing of subject access requests; reporting sickness of staff members to team leads.
* Receiving incoming post, emails and telephone calls in a courteous, professional manner; attending and contributing to staff meetings and supporting developments within the service.
* Using own initiative to deal with day-to-day issues and liaising with Clinical Leads and Team Leads; carrying out duties as reasonably delegated or requested by Clinical Leads, including PA support as required.
* To provide day-to-day administrative support and contribute to service planning and development in relation to administration systems and procedures.
* To order and maintain adequate levels of stationery and equipment as required by the team, authorised by the Lead; maintain expected standards of office safety and security.
* To make up patient Yellow Files, add to System One, and discharge when the service has completed treatment.
* To support the team in day-to-day running, including ordering PPE, saving caseloads onto USB sticks, and answering the phone.
* Word processing of reports and letters, including amending and tidying documents, drafting routine correspondence for approval, and taking formal minutes of meetings as required using software such as Word, Excel and PowerPoint.
* Maintain and update IT and maintenance databases with team issues; keeping office systems up-to-date (e.g., bring forward) and writing up meeting notes where required.
* Receiving and sorting internal and external mail and dealing with it appropriately.

Additional Information

We are the main provider of NHS community services across East and West Sussex, with 6,000 staff serving 1.3 million people. We deliver essential care to adults and children, helping them manage their health, avoid hospital admissions, and reduce hospital stays. Our Trust vision is to provide excellent care at the heart of the community. We offer opportunities across medical, clinical, support, and corporate services.
